General Bergenite Information

Help on Chemical  Formula: Chemical Formula: Ca2Ba4[(UO3)2O2(PO4)2]3 (H2O)16
Help on Composition: Composition: Molecular Weight = 3,299.70 gm
   Barium      16.65 %  Ba   18.59 % BaO
   Calcium      2.43 %  Ca    3.40 % CaO
   Uranium     43.28 %  U    52.01 % UO3
   Phosphorus   5.63 %  P    12.91 % P2O5
   Hydrogen     0.98 %  H     8.74 % H2O
   Oxygen      31.03 %  O
              ______        ______ 
              100.00 %       95.64 % = TOTAL OXIDE
Help on Empirical Formula: Empirical Formula: Ca2Ba43(UO3)23(O2)3(PO4)2(H2O)16
Help on Environment: Environment: Secondary uranium phosphate mineral.
Help on IMA Status: IMA Status: Approved IMA 1959
Help on Locality: Locality: Mine dump at Streuberg, Bergen, Saxony, Germany. Link to MinDat.org Location Data.
Help on Name Origin: Name Origin: Named for the locality.

Bergenite Crystallography

Help on Axial Ratios: Axial Ratios: a:b:c =0.5852:1:1.0063
Help on Cell Dimensions: Cell Dimensions: a = 10.092, b = 17.245, c = 17.355, Z = 2; beta = 113.678° V = 2,766.14 Den(Calc)= 3.96
Help on Crystal System: Crystal System: Monoclinic - PrismaticH-M Symbol (2/m) Space Group: P 21/c
Help on X Ray Diffraction: X Ray Diffraction: By Intensity(I/Io): 7.73(1), 3.837(0.8), 3.054(0.6),

Physical Properties of Bergenite

Help on Cleavage: Cleavage: [???] Perfect
Help on Color: Color: Yellow, Greenish yellow.
Help on Density: Density: 4.1
Help on Diaphaniety: Diaphaniety: Semitransparent
Help on Habit: Habit: Acicular - Occurs as needle-like crystals.
Help on Habit: Habit: Tabular - Form dimensions are thin in one direction.
Help on Hardness: Hardness: 2-3 - Gypsum-Calcite
Help on Luminescence: Luminescence: Fluorescent and radioactive, Short UV=pale green.
Help on Streak: Streak: yellow white
 

Optical Properties of Bergenite

Help on Gladstone-Dale: Gladstone-Dale: CI meas= -0.165 (Poor) - where the CI = (1-KPDmeas/KC)
CI calc= -0.206 (Poor) - where the CI = (1-KPDcalc/KC)
KPDcalc= 0.1757,KPDmeas= 0.1697,KC= 0.1456
Help on Optical Data: Optical Data: Biaxial (-), a=1.66, b=1.7-1.71, g=1.722, bire=0.0620
Help on Pleochroism (x): Pleochroism (x): colorless.
Help on Pleochroism (y): Pleochroism (y): colorless.
Help on Pleochroism (z): Pleochroism (z): colorless.
